Где хранить бэкапы? Разбираем плюсы и минусы популярных решений
Разберём преимущества и недостатки популярных решений создания и хранения резервных копий: от локальных устройств до облачных сервисов и ви��туальных выделенных серверов.
Что такое бэкап?
Бэкап (от английского backup) − это резервная копия ваших данных. Данные − это всё то важное, что хранится на вашем компьютере, смартфоне или на сервере: фотографии, документы, видео, базы данных, настройки программ, переписки и даже целые операционные системы, в том числе и вашего компьютера. Бэкап создаётся для того, чтобы в случае потери, повреждения или удаления оригинальных данных их можно было восстановить — и сделать это должно быть достаточно легко.
Представьте, что у вас есть важный документ на компьютере. Если файл случайно удалится или его повредит вирус, вы потеряете доступ к содержащейся в нём информации. Для такого документа, то есть файла, бэкап − это страховка: даже если с оригиналом что-то произойдёт, то у вас будет копия, которую можно использовать для восстановления информации.
Как работает бэкап?
Сначала вы копируете свои данные, неважно, как вы это делаете, вручную или с помощью специальных приложений. Затем сохраняете их в где-то другом месте. При этом копия ваших данных должна храниться отдельно от оригинала, например, на внешнем жёстком диске, в облаке, или, может быть, на флешке.
Если по каким-то причинам оригинальные данные вдруг потерялись, вы можете взять копию из бэкапа и вернуть всё в исходное состояние.
Например, за продолжительный период времени вы сделали огромное количество снимков, но телефон неожиданно вышел из строя. Если у вас был бэкап где-нибудь в облаке, вы просто загружаете фотографии обратно уже на новый смартфон.
Как часто нужно делать бэкапы?
Частота создания резервных копий зависит от того, как часто изменяются сохраняемые данные. Например, если вы работаете с важными документами или базами данных, делать бэкап таких данных необходимо ежедневно. А вот личные файлы, которые обновляются редко, можно резервировать еженедельно. Внеочередное резервирование данных рекомендуется делать перед обновлением системы или установкой новой версии программного обеспечения, которое отвечает за доступность информации.
Где хранить бэкапы?
Системы или сервисы, предназначенные для хранения резервных копий данных, можно условно разделить на несколько различных типов:
- Локальные хранилища − физические устройства, расположенные на месте, например, в офисе или дома.
- Облачные хранилища − удалённые сервисы, предоставляемые сторонними провайдерами, например, Yandex Disk, Amazon S3, Dropbox, Google Cloud, Microsoft Azure, Backblaze.
- Виртуальные выделенные серверы − один из видов виртуальных серверов, который часто используется для различных задач, включая хранение бэкапов.
Локальные хранилища
Локальные хранилища − это устройства или системы для хранения данных, которые находятся физически рядом с вами, например, в вашем доме или офисе. Они используются для создания резервных копий и хранения важной информации без необходимости подключения к интернету.
К таким устройствам относятся внешние жёсткие диски, сетевые хранилища (NAS), ленточные накопители, флеш-накопители.
Все эти устройства обладают одним неоспоримым преимуществом − сохраняя резервные копии с их помощью, вы полностью управляете своими данными и можете быть уверены в их конфиденциальности, поскольку сами являетесь владельцем этих устройств. У вас нет необходимости вносить какую-либо абонентскую плату, цена использования этих устройств ограничена лишь стоимостью их самих. Кроме того, для использования локальных хранилищ нет необходимости в подключении к интернету.
Есть у такого типа устройств и свои недостатки. Прежде всего, это то, что они подвержены разного рода повреждениям вследствие каких-либо форс-мажорных обстоятельств, или банально по причине физического износа. Также объём данных, которые можно на них скопировать, ограничен размером самих устройств. Для увеличения их ёмкости необходимо приобретать новые устройства. Кроме того, покупка качественных устройств, например, NAS или SSD, может быть довольно затратным мероприятием.
Отдельно следует описать такую технологию, как NAS. NAS (Network Attached Storage) − это сетевое хранилище данных, которое подключается к локальной сети и предоставляет централизованное место для хранения файлов, доступное пользователям и устройствам. По сути, такое хранилище представляет собой специализированное устройство или сервер. NAS подключается к роутеру или коммутатору через Ethernet, становясь частью локальной сети. Устройства в сети (компьютеры, смартфоны, Smart TV) получают доступ к данным на NAS через протоколы передачи файлов. Внутри NAS установлены жёсткие диски или твердотельные накопители, которые могут быть объединены в RAID-массивы для повышения надёжности. Данные на NAS доступны через веб-интерфейс, мобильные приложения или напрямую через сетевые папки.
И да, выше мы упомянули ленточные накопители. Они до сих пор используются для хранения бэкапов благодаря низкой стоимости хранения больших объёмов данных и долговечности. Ленточные накопители обеспечивают высокую надёжность и подходят для долгосрочного архивирования, что делает их популярными в корпоративной среде, где важно хранить огромные объёмы данных.
Облачные хранилища
Ещё один тип хранилищ − это облачные хранилища. К ним относятся удалённые сервисы для хранения данных, которые предоставляются сторонними ��омпаниями. В отличие от локальных хранилищ, данные в облаке хранятся на серверах провайдера и доступны через интернет.
Для сохранения резервной копии вы загружаете файлы на серверы провайдера через веб-интерфейс, приложение или API. Данные хранятся в распределённых дата-центрах провайдера, которые обеспечивают высокую надёжность и доступность. В такой конфигурации вы можете получить доступ к своим файлам с любого устройства через интернет. Многие облачные хранилища поддерживают синхронизацию данных между устройствами. Например, файл, загруженны�� на компьютер, автоматически становится доступен с вашего смартфона. Кроме того, многие облачные хранилища поддерживают резервное копирование в автоматическом режиме. При этом нет необходимости покупать и обслуживать собственные серверы или жёсткие диски.
К недостаткам такого вида хранилищ можно отнести то, что тарифы на их использование могут быть высокими, особенно для больших объёмов данных. К тому же данные в таком случае хранятся у третьих лиц, что может быть неприемлемо для конфиденциальной информации.
Виртуальные выделенные серверы
Что касается использования VPS в качестве хранилища для бэкапов, то это довольно популярное решение. VPS (Virtual Private Server) предоставляет гибкость, контроль над данными и возможность настройки под конкретные задачи.
VPS − это виртуальный выделенный сервер, который создаётся на физическом сервере с использованием технологий виртуализации. Пользователь получает выделенные ресурсы, такие как процессор, оперативную память, дисковое пространство, и полный контроль над виртуальной машиной, как если бы это был собственный физический сервер. На VPS можно настроить файловое хранилище, куда будут загружаться бэкапы. При использовании VPS вы полностью управляете сервером и можете настроить его под свои нужды, например, установить необходимое программное обеспечение, настроить права доступа, шифрование. В любой момент у вас есть возможность легко увеличить объём дискового пространства, оперативной памяти и других ресурсов по мере необходимости. Данные, сохранённые на VPS, доступны из любой точки мира через интернет. На VPS можно настроить автоматическое создание, загрузку и удаление бэкапов с помощью скриптов или специализированного софта. Кроме того, на виртуальной машине вы можете настроить брандмауэр, шифрование данных и другие дополнительные меры безопасности.
Недостатком VPS является то, что ресурсы такого сервера (CPU, RAM, дисковое пространство) ограничены тарифным планом. Также для доступа к данным на VPS требуется стабильное интернет-соединение.
VPS подходит для организаций, которым не требуются огромные объёмы для сохранения резервных копий, и при этом нужен контроль над сервером. Но даже если вам нужно сохранить данные приличного объёма, то, например, при заказе виртуальной машины на хостинге RUVDS есть возможность приобрести дополнительный «Большой Диск» размером до 18 Терабайт.
Многие провайдеры VPS используют RAID-массивы и другие технологии резервирования, что снижает риск потери данных практически до нуля. К тому же, дата-центры, например, хостинга RUVDS, расположенные в нескольких городах и странах, спроектированы в соответствии с категорией надёжности TIER III, что обеспечивает уровень отказоустойчивости на уровне 99,98%.
Что в итоге?
Выбор хранилища для бэкапов − важный шаг, определяющий, насколько надёжно будут защищены ваши данные. Каждое из рассмотренных решений − и локальные хранилища, и облачные сервисы, и VPS имеет свои преимущества и недостатки, и оптимальный выбор зависит от ваших задач, объёма данных, бюджета и требований к безопасности.